The article provides a brief description of the main terms and concepts of kidney damage used in forensic medicine and urology, with a list of requirements for the description and formation of a clinical diagnosis when maintaining primary medical documentation. The importance of a unified approach in objective interpretation in the expert assessment of kidney injuries is substantiated.

INTRODUCTION: The kidney concussion causes damage to intraorganic angioarchitectonics, microcirculatory disorders, as a consequence - a decrease in functional capabilities of the organ, affecting inter-system interrelationships in the organism. PURPOSE OF THE STUDY: to evaluate the interaction of renal functions and hemodynamic homeostasis by the method of correlation adaptometry in groups of victims after closed kidney injury with different areas of organ damage. MATERIALS AND METHODS: The study involved 114 patients with isolated comotional kidney injury Grade I-III, with the involvement of the 1st organ segment - 30 (26.0%), 2 segments - 26 (22.8%), 3 segments - 58 (51.2%). A radionuclide study was performed, the parameters of hemodynamic homeostasis were determined, and the functional stress index (IFN) was calculated. The assessment of the contingency of the analyzed parameters was carried out on the basis of correlation analysis, and the degree of connectivity of the parameters was estimated using the correlation graph. RESULTS: It was found that with an increase in the number of damaged segments of the kidney, the main physiological parameters of the organ regress together with an increase in functional deficit. Vector decrease of functional capabilities of the organism by IFN was noted: from satisfactory adaptation (when kidney segment 1 was injured); through tension of adaptation mechanisms (2 segments); to unsatisfactory adaptation (3 segments), when homeostasis was preserved with significant tension of regulatory systems. The correlation graph was recorded at the level of 11,96 and 11,57 in trauma of the 1st and 2nd segments of the kidney. In case of damage to 3 segments of the organ, the weight of the correlation graph increases - 16,97, which indicates pronounced structural and functional maladaptive disorders in the activity of the organ. CONCLUSION: assessment of the conjugacy of indicators of renal and organism interaction, indicates the greatest tension of the reserves of functional potential of the organism in case of damage of 3 segments of the kidney.

INTRODUCTION: Damage to the structure of the kidney in blunt trauma leads to disruption of angioarchitectonics and microcirculation. OBJECTIVE: to establish the dependence of renal function and circulatory system on the severity of injury and the type of blunt renal trauma. MATERIALS AND METHODS: The clinical and laboratory homeostasis tests were carried out in 127 patients with the kidney parenchyma contusion and ruptures in the nearest posttraumatic period. RESULTS: Five factors and five clusters of signs were revealed. Tissue level reactions predominate in case of contusion injury of less than half of the organ. Trauma of more than half of the kidney and parenchyma rupture involve the circulatory system in the response reaction. CONCLUSION: the volume/area and type of damage are predictors in the level of the functional response of the organism - organ or organismal.

INTRODUCTION: Blunt renal trauma manifest at macro- and microstructural levels as concussions, bruises or lacerations. The pyelonephritis predominates in structure of posttraumatic compli- cations. AIM: To study immune changes in patients with renal trauma and their effect on the development of inflammatory post-traumatic complications. MATERIALS AND METHODS: Multivariate statistical analysis of immunological parameters in the immediate post-traumatic period in 92 patients with 2-3 degrees of isolated blunt renal trauma, according to the classification OIS/OI AAST, 2018), was carried out. RESULTS: three main components were identified: the first was associated with the lymphocyte count; the second component included high indicators of adaptive cellular immunity CD+19, CD+8, while the third component represented indicators of nonspecific humoral immunity. They accounted for 43.7%, 37.5% and 18.9% of the variance of intergroup differences, respectively. A strong negative correlation between neutrophils and lymphocytes and a weak positive correlation between IgM and IgG were revealed, which altogether indicated the preserved adaptive response of the immune system. CONCLUSION: The multivariate analysis of immunological reactivity suggests a sufficient degree of mobilization of the immune system for the adequate adaptive response in patients with isolated blunt kidney trauma, which makes the prediction of the development of post-traumatic pyelonephritis doubtful.
